Barberton police officer injured after being struck with hammer during domestic violence call

BARBERTON, Ohio — 3News has learned that a Barberton police officer was injured Monday morning after being struck with a hammer while responding to a domestic violence call.

According to a Barberton police report, officers were called around 6:45 a.m. to a home in the 600 block of Charles Avenue for a reported domestic violence incident involving an adult son and his father.

Police say the father reported that his son, Jacob Culbertson, 34, had been drinking throughout the night and became disruptive inside the home. The father told officers that Culbertson threw a nearly empty beer can at him and struck him with a rubberized object. A domestic violence statement was later completed…
